Parragon readies Beauty and the Beast line

Storybooks and activity books to launch to coincide with new Disney live action film.

With the highly anticipated Disney live action movie due to arrive on March 17, Parragon is readying for the launch of its accompanying Beauty and the Beast publishing collection.

The primary formats in the range will consist of storybooks and activity books, with the key target audience being eight to 16 year olds.

Titles will include Beauty and the Beast: Book of the Film, Beauty and the Beast: Design & Doodle and Beauty and the Beast: Write, Inspire & Create.

These will line up alongside the original novelisation, Lost In A Book, which Parragon confirmed at the end of January.

The Beauty and the Beast range will be supported with a website presence, in addition to social media activity across Parragon’s Facebook, Twitter and Instagram channels.

Duncan Hamilton, director of licensing EMEA of Parragon, said: “We are really pleased with our new Beauty and the Beast product range.

“We hope our products will delight and inspire children and young adults, and especially encourage girls to be brave like Belle and chase their wildest dreams.”
